Output 63869de2b077f986fabcdd7a426f05b6c121845c6640c1a4b3fe259b7bbf87e8:1

value
17975028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d95dab6aa2ce284ee80929477795361c8cdd12c OP_EQUALVERIFY OP_CHECKSIG
address
1FNEcBSxs6C7vWf5wUKM7SnfPe9jjy1FKY
transaction
63869de2b077f986fabcdd7a426f05b6c121845c6640c1a4b3fe259b7bbf87e8
confirmations
286418
spent
true